78 * Design Notes for Job Management
79 * -------------------------------
83 * pending Do nothing/check jobs
84 * pending-held Send SIGTERM to filters and backend
85 * processing Do nothing/start job
86 * stopped Send SIGKILL to filters and backend
87 * canceled Send SIGTERM to filters and backend
91 * Finalize clears the printer <-> job association, deletes the status
92 * buffer, closes all of the pipes, etc. and doesn't get run until all of
93 * the print processes are finished.
95 * UNLOADING OF JOBS (cupsdUnloadCompletedJobs)
97 * We unload the job attributes when they are not needed to reduce overall
98 * memory consumption. We don't unload jobs where job->state_value <
99 * IPP_JOB_STOPPED, job->printer != NULL, or job->access_time is recent.
101 * STARTING OF JOBS (start_job)
103 * When a job is started, a status buffer, several pipes, a security
104 * profile, and a backend process are created for the life of that job.
105 * These are shared for every file in a job. For remote print jobs, the
106 * IPP backend is provided with every file in the job and no filters are
109 * The job->printer member tracks which printer is printing a job, which
110 * can be different than the destination in job->dest for classes. The
111 * printer object also has a job pointer to track which job is being
114 * PRINTING OF JOB FILES (cupsdContinueJob)
116 * Each file in a job is filtered by 0 or more programs. After getting the
117 * list of filters needed and the total cost, the job is either passed or
118 * put back to the processing state until the current FilterLevel comes down
119 * enough to allow printing.
121 * If we can print, we build a string for the print options and run each of
122 * the filters, piping the output from one into the next.
124 * JOB STATUS UPDATES (update_job)
126 * The update_job function gets called whenever there are pending messages
127 * on the status pipe. These generally are updates to the marker-*,
128 * printer-state-message, or printer-state-reasons attributes. On EOF,
129 * finalize_job is called to clean up.
131 * FINALIZING JOBS (finalize_job)
133 * When all filters and the backend are done, we set the job state to
134 * completed (no errors), aborted (filter errors or abort-job policy),
135 * pending-held (auth required or retry-job policy), or pending
136 * (retry-current-job or stop-printer policies) as appropriate.
138 * Then we close the pipes and free the status buffers and profiles.
140 * JOB FILE COMPLETION (process_children in main.c)
142 * For multiple-file jobs, process_children (in main.c) sees that all
143 * filters have exited and calls in to print the next file if there are
144 * more files in the job, otherwise it waits for the backend to exit and
145 * update_job to do the cleanup.
